Transaction fb73c7701617389ccceef3c85508ccb8c403d86ae2b90fda8ac607acb1a0e60c

1 Input
2 Outputs
  • fb73c7701617389ccceef3c85508ccb8c403d86ae2b90fda8ac607acb1a0e60c:0
  • value  100000000
    address  15ET3H3xC6pn5HRUzfkPtmhCQc9fvfejvt
  • fb73c7701617389ccceef3c85508ccb8c403d86ae2b90fda8ac607acb1a0e60c:1
  • value  47425942099
    address  16uyk25JVTFE4Wu7wMqK91gLDnxqUdqnvg